Table 1 Healthcare services for intervention and control groups

From: More cost-effective management of patients with musculoskeletal disorders in primary care after direct triaging to physiotherapists for initial assessment compared to initial general practitioner assessment

 

Intervention

N = 27

TAU

N = 26

P-value

Physiotherapist, n (%)

12 (44)

10 (38)

0.649

GP, n (%)

7 (26)

4 (15)

0.242

Referrals, n (%)

1 (4)

7 (27)

0.019

Prescriptions, n (%)

7 (26)

9 (35)

0.516

Sick-notes, n (%)

4 (15)

4 (15)

1.000

  1. Intervention = Initially triaged to physiotherapists. TAU = Treatment as usual (initially triaged to GPs). Physiotherapist and GP = number of cases with visits after the triage visit. Referrals, prescriptions, sick-notes = number of cases receiving MSD-related referrals, prescriptions or sick-notes from GPs during 1 year from the triage visit
